2,147,554,428 (two billion one hundred forty-seven million five hundred fifty-four thousand four hundred twenty-eight) is an even 10-digit number. It is a composite number with 24 divisors, and factors as 2² × 3 × 449 × 398,581. Its proper divisors sum to 2,874,578,772,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x8001147C.
